Segway Tour Rider Requirements
Recommended Minimum Age: 12 years and over ***please contact us on +61 404350503 prior to booking if a guest is below the minimun age limit to discuss possible tour options.
Recommended over 40 kg and under 120 kg ***please contact us on +61 404350503 prior to booking if a guest does not meet the recommended weight range to discuss tour optiions
Guests under 18 years of age must have a waiver signed by a parent or guardian.
Pregnant guests are not recommended on the tour due to fall risk.
Not recommended for guests with some mobility or motor control issues. Guests must be able to easily and quickly step on and off the Segway without assistance, which requires physical abilities similar to climbing and descending stairs without any assistance or use of a handrail.
Kangaroo Segway Tours has a strict policy against alcohol consumption and Segway operation. Alcohol is forbidden on all Segway tours and any client suspected of drinking before or during a Segway tour will immediately forfeit their tour and no refund will be given.
Helmets are provided and required (you can bring your own helmets if they meet Australian Helmet Standards).
No thongs, flip-flops, open-toe sandals, or high heels.
Sign guest liability waiver.
Respect other tour guests, road signs, pedestrians, bikes and cars for a safe enjoyable ride.

Just want to note a few things not for the business but for anyone looking to book - on the day I went, the botanic gardens were closed (no fault of Kangaroo Segway Tours, but if you’re booking your tour for the afternoon during Brisbane festival, you should check that the gardens aren’t closing early for light shows to make sure you get to see the gardens! Book earlier at about noon if in doubt).
Also, right up until my 3pm booking, I was very uncertain about whether I’d been scammed because there was no sign or indication anywhere in the Kennards facility that we were in the right place. Even after I called I still harboured uncertainties because our tour guide didn’t come out to greet us until right before the booking time (we got there early like the instructions said).
But worry not, this is a legitimate business - even if you don’t see a sign, just wait near the ‘Storage things’ sign (font resembles stranger things) and you’ll soon be whizzing about Brisbane! I think the sign is usually out from other reviews, and I saw the sign in the storage container, and I’d recommend to the tour guides to please leave it out for first timers.
